I never got into Zelda until about a year ago, and I can't believe I missed out on such a great series all these years.
I've completed A Link to the Past and The Wind Waker, two of my favourite games of all time on any system, and am some ways through Ocarina by way of the Collector's Edition disc for the Cube. I've also played a bit of the Oracle titles for Game Boy Color thanks to several hours abord Singapore Air, but didn't get into them as much - I don't consider them as integral a part of the series proper. As far as internal consistency goes, it's true that there isn't really any. My approach to the series is that the individual entries are really just permutations of an ancient legend, hence the title of the series, The Legend of Zelda. Outside of that, the reality is that plot consistency was never something taken into much consideration in game design until the late '90s. Trying to establish total consistency is futile and arguably as problematic as doing the same with, say, Star Trek; I think the varied approaches to the trinity of Power, Courage and Wisdom (and the Hero, Princess and Villain) lend themselves to a certain timelessness that isn't overly repetitive. There already is a multiplayer Zelda for GBA, Four Swords, which is similar to LttP in look and feel but relies on cooperative dungeon-crawling. I'm quite looking forward to Four Swords Adventures, the upcoming GameCube version of this.

I'm honestly more excited for Twilight Princess than for anything coming out on Xbox 360, which is going to be released around the same time. It's on par with the first wave of next-generation titles, which I find are dropping on us way too prematurely.
I adore the Wind Waker look, and Princess doesn't seem to have any of that lush, adorable greenery, but it's got a very unique tone to call its own - kind of like what everybody remembers Ocarina of Time to be, before they realize that N64 graphics look kind of clunky nowadays.
